1 Introduction
Secure Trading Payment Pages are for merchants who need a simple and easily-implemented
method of adding e-payment capability to their online commerce systems. Secure Trading
Payment Pages works with custom-designed ecommerce systems as well as with many
commercially available shopping cart applications.
Using Secure Trading Payment Pages you can:
Process payments on our own dedicated HTTPS servers (that use the SSL protocol)
that allow you to process secure and reliable transactions.
Process payments without storing credit card details on your server.
Customise the Payment Pages with custom HTML/CSS to maintain the look and feel of
your online store.
Accept a large variety of currencies.
Track all transactions using our online transaction management system, MyST.

2.5 Settlement
Please note that the procedure outlined in this section of the document applies to
card-based payment methods. For further information on other payment types,
please refer to additional Secure Trading documentation on our website, or
contact your acquiring bank / payment provider.
Once a transaction has been authorised the funds are then reserved against the customer’s
account for 7 days* while awaiting settlement. The instruction to transfer the funds is scheduled
daily when Secure Trading submits a batch of all transactions that are pending settlement to
your acquirer. This process is called settlement and is outlined below:
Step 1: Secure Trading submit settlement file to the acquirer
The initial phase of the settlement process occurs when Secure Trading submits a file to your
acquirer. The file contains all transactions that are in status pending settlement, and this
occurs daily.
Step 2: The funds are transferred to your bank account
When the acquirer has received the settlement file from Secure Trading, your acquirer
commences the process of physically settling the money into your nominated bank account.
The time frame of this payment differs between banks, and is beyond Secure Trading’s control.
Please note that if reserved funds are not settled, they are released back onto
the customer’s card. We recommend that you regularly log in to MyST to check
the status of your payments.
2.5.1 Deferred settlement
Settlement can be deferred for certain transactions. You can request this (see section 4.6), or
transactions may be deferred by Secure Trading’s internal fraud system (if enabled on your
account). You should therefore sign in to MyST on a regular basis, to check the status of your
transactions. Please refer to the MyST User Guide for further information.
2.6 Split Shipments
Split shipments provide you with more control over when reserved funds are settled. Instead of
performing a single settlement within 7 days* as is the case with a standard authorisation, with
split shipments you can perform multiple partial settlements.
STPP supports split shipments for certain acquirers. For further information, please refer to the
Split Shipment Guide.
*Please note that certain acquiring banks have different procedures in regards to
settlement with payments made with MasterCard. These differences are
described in section 4.9.

4.9 Pre-Authorisations and Final Authorisations
MasterCard Europe have mandated that MasterCard and Maestro transactions processed with
certain European acquiring banks must be flagged as either pre-authorisation or final
authorisation. Such transactions are subject to acquirer-specific conditions.
We recommend that you contact your acquirer for information on whether this mandate applies
to your configuration and to clarify whether to process your transactions as pre-authorisations or
final authorisations.
By default, Secure Trading will process MasterCard and Maestro authorisations as final
authorisations. You can change this default behaviour to submit pre-authorisations, by
contacting Secure Trading Support (see section 16.1).
Alternatively, see section 4.9.2 for information on overriding the default behaviour on a
transaction-by-transaction basis.
4.9.1 About Pre-Authorisations and Final Authorisations
Pre-authorisation and final authorisation can be summarised as follows:
Pre-Authorisation:
Settlement can be deferred by up to 7 days following authorisation.
Funds are reserved on the customer’s account for up to 30 days.
During this time, the amount to be settled can be updated to a value that is lower than
the amount authorised.
Pre-authorisations are more flexible than final authorisations, but may be subject to
higher processing fees by your acquiring bank.
Final authorisation:
Settlement can only be deferred by up to 4 days following
authorisation (1) (2).
Funds are reserved on the customer’s account for up to 7 days.
Following authorisation, the amount value should not be changed (1).
Final authorisations are less flexible than pre-authorisations, but may be subject to
lower processing fees by your acquiring bank.
(1) Failure to adhere to these conditions may incur a fine from MasterCard.
(2) Secure Trading will allow final authorisations to be settled up to 7 days
after authorisation, but you should aim to settle within 4 days to avoid
incurring a fine.
For full terms and conditions, please contact your acquiring bank.
Split shipments require the initial authorisation to be sent through as a pre-
authorisation. Please refer to the Split Shipment Guide for further information.
4.9.2 Override
You can include the authmethod field in the HTTP POST to indicate whether the payment is a
pre-authorisation or a final authorisation. This overrides the default behaviour when submitted.
The values that can be submitted are:
“PRE” - Requests a “pre-authorisation”.
“FINAL” - Requests a “final authorisation” (default).

4.10 Charset
In order for data to be transmitted, the customer’s browser encodes it using a character
encoding. Secure Trading’s servers need to know this encoding (or charset) in order to correctly
decode the data. Many browsers do not provide this information, in which case Secure Trading
will assume the character encoding is ISO-8859-1. This is compatible with all browsers but can
result in some characters (in particular non-western characters) being interpreted incorrectly.
You can tell the browser to specify the correct charset by including a hidden field _charset_
within your HTML form. Browsers will automatically fill the value of this field with the charset
they are using, so there is no need to specify a value for this field, for example:
<INPUT TYPE=hidden NAME=”_charset_” />
Please note that you can find more information on charset, by referring to
http://en.wikipedia.org/wiki/Character_encoding

6 Security
To ensure the request to Secure Trading has not been modified by a malicious user, a field
called sitesecurity can be included in the POST to the Payment Pages. This field contains
a cryptographic hash of a predefined set of field values.
Any field that you do not want the customer to modify must be included in
your site security hash. For example:
If you are submitting address details in the request to Payment Pages, you must
include the fields in the site security hash in order to prevent the customer
changing their address.
Follow the steps below to use this security feature:
Step 1: Field Selection
You will need to notify Secure Trading Support (see section 16.1) of the fields to include in the
hash. The default fields for new accounts are:
currencyiso3a
mainamount
sitereference
settlestatus
settleduedate
authmethod
paypaladdressoverride
strequiredfields
version
stprofile
ruleidentifier
stdefaultprofile
successfulurlredirect
declinedurlredirect
successfulurlnotification
declinedurlnotification
merchantemail
allurlnotification
stextraurlnotifyfields
stextraurlredirectfields
password
Secure Trading recommends including as many unique fields when creating the hash as
possible. Including only the merchant and currency fields will end up creating the same hash
even though the amount field may have been compromised. To prevent anyone from changing
the amount, we recommend including the mainamount field.
Please note that although the fields authmethod, settlestatus and
settleduedate are optional, they can affect settlement. Even if these fields are
not submitted to Secure Trading, we recommend including them when you set up
the fields with support. The way the hash is generated will not change, but it will
mean that a malicious user will not be able to affect the settlement of a
transaction through your account.
Once the fields have been chosen, you will need to provide Secure Trading with a password
that is appended to the end of the hash. If you would like to change the password or
add/remove fields from the hash you must notify Secure Trading support.
Secure Trading will never ask for your Site Security password after
first-time configuration. Never share your Site Security password with third
parties. Do not store hard copies of this password.
Payment Pages Setup Guide
© Secure Trading Limited 2015
31 December 2015
Page 31 / 77
Step 2: Hash Generation
You will need to set up your system to generate the hash using the SHA-256 algorithm. When

7.1 Risk Decision
The purpose of Risk Decision requests is to minimise fraud by analysing customer details and
highlighting possible fraudulent activity by using Secure Trading’s Fraud Control system. This is
to assist you in making a decision of whether or not to process a customer’s transaction, based
on the perceived level of risk.
This is achieved by checking the industry’s largest negative database and also searching for
suspicious patterns in user activity. The system uses neural-based fraud assessments that can
be configured specifically for your account and is constantly updating the fraud checks used to
combat new risks.
Based on the decision returned by the Fraud Control system a customer that is deemed as
suspicious can be prevented from processing a payment.
To enable Fraud Control on your account, please contact Secure Trading Support (see section
16.1).
7.1.1 Process
Once the customer submits their details to the Payment Pages a Risk Decision assessment is
processed by the Fraud Control system, where the billing, delivery and payment details are
analysed by a rule-based system and includes:
The industry’s largest negative database.
Neural-based fraud assessments.
Tumbling or swapping, where there is an unusual usage pattern in the card number,
expiration date or customer details associated with a transaction.
Please note dependent on your Fraud Control profile, the rules can be configured
specifically for your account. For more information, contact Secure Trading
Support (see section 16.1).
The Fraud Control system will analyse these details and respond with one of the following
results:
ACCEPT - The details are not deemed suspicious.
DENY- The details are suspicious and a transaction should not be performed.
CHALLENGE - Further investigation is recommended.
7.1.2 Performing Authorisations automatically based on Risk Decision responses
Based on the result of the Risk Decision, you can decide whether to automatically proceed with
the Authorisation or not. By default, the Payment Pages have the following process flow:
1. If the Risk Decision returns an Accept, then continue with the authorisation.
2. If the Risk Decision returns a Challenge or Deny, then process the authorisation, but
suspend the transaction allowing for further investigation.
Please note the default process flow can be customised. For example, you could
choose not to process the authorisation if the Risk Decision returns a Deny.
For more information, contact Secure Trading Support (see section 16.1).

7.2 Account Check
An Account Check is an optional request to help minimise fraud. It allows payment details to be
validated, and checks that the details entered by the customer matches those on the card
issuer’s records. No funds will be reserved or transferred by the Account Check request.
Please note that Account Checks are only available for certain Acquiring Banks.
Please contact the Secure Trading support team for more information (see
section 16.1).
Payment Pages Setup Guide
© Secure Trading Limited 2015
31 December 2015
Page 36 / 77
The checks performed by an Account Check Request consist of the following:
Use of the Address Verification System (AVS) to check if the provided first line of the
billing address for the customer matches that on the card issuer’s records.
Checks to see if the billing postcode provided by the customer matches that on record
for their card.
Checks to see if the security code (CVV2) provided by the customer matches that on
record for their card.
Please note that the checks performed on an Account Check Request are the
same as those carried out on a regular e-commerce Authorisation (AUTH)
Request.
Please refer to the STPP AVS & CVV2 document (see section 16.3) for further
information on address and security code checks.
No funds will be reserved as part of an Account Check.
The results of these checks are returned in the security response of the Account Check.
The security response consists of three different fields, each containing the result of an
individual check. The names of the fields are listed, below:
Field name
Comment
securityresponseaddress
The results of the checks performed by the AVS on
the first line of the billing address.
securityresponsepostcode
The results of the checks on the billing postcode.
securityresponsesecuritycode
The results of the security code checks.
An Account Check Request will analyse the details provided by the customer and respond with
the following results for each check performed:
Security response value
Description
Comment
0
“Not Given”
Your bank was not provided with the
information required to perform this check.
1
“Not Checked”
Your bank was unable to perform checks on
the information provided.
2
“Matched”
The information provided by the customer
matches that on the card issuer’s records.
4
“Not Matched
The information provided by the customer
does NOT match that on the card issuer’s
records.
For example, if the securityresponseaddress and securityresponsepostcode have a
value of 2, but the securityresponsesecuritycode has a value of 4, this indicates that the
first line of the address and the postcode match those on the card issuer’s records, but the
security code (CVV2) entered by the customer does not match the code found on the back of
their card.

7.3 3-D Secure
3-D Secure is a protocol designed to reduce fraud and Chargebacks during e-commerce
Internet transactions. Cardholders are asked to identify themselves at the point of sale before
the purchase can be completed. This usually means entering a PIN or other password after
entering their credit card details.
In the event of a dispute with the transaction at a later date, the card issuer will usually take
responsibility of the Chargeback instead of the merchant. The liability issues involved with 3-D
Secure transactions are out of the scope of this document. For a detailed indication of the
liabilities involved, contact your bank.
3-D Secure transactions may be processed to reduce the likelihood of fraudulent transactions
on your account. It may take several weeks to enable 3-D Secure depending on your acquirer.
Please contact Secure Trading support for more information (see section 16.1).
Please note that only certain payment types support 3-D Secure.
7.3.1 Process
A THREEDQUERY request is used to determine whether the customer’s card is enrolled in the
3-D Secure scheme. The THREEDQUERY request submits information to a directory server
hosted by a card issuer (e.g. Visa). If the card is in the 3-D Secure scheme, then after the
customer has entered their payment details, they will be redirected to a log-in screen that
enables them to validate their identity through an Access Control Server (ACS), hosted by their
card issuer.
Please note that the size of the ACS page displayed in the customer’s browser is
controlled by the ACS provider (cannot be modified by merchants or Secure
Trading).
As a guideline, Visa US states that the Verified by Visa authentication window
should be 390x400 pixels in size.

7.5 Currency Rate
Currency Rate Requests are used when performing Dynamic Currency Conversion (DCC)
transactions. The CURRENCYRATE Request contains the currency information required for the
currency conversion provider to return a conversion rate based on the current rates. By
enabling CURRENCYRATE Requests on your Payment Pages, the customer is able to choose
an alternative currency in which to perform the payment, provided their card supports the
currency conversion.
Please note that in order to perform DCC, you will need to have a merchant
number that allows this functionality. For more information, please contact your
acquiring bank.
In addition, an account with a currency rate provider is required. To set up a
currency rate provider on your Secure Trading account, please contact Secure
Trading Sales (see section 16.2).
Payment Pages Setup Guide
© Secure Trading Limited 2015
31 December 2015
Page 41 / 77
7.5.1 Process
The steps to process a payment with a CURRENCYRATE request are the same as processing
a standard authorisation using the Payment Pages (see section 3), with additional DCC fields
included in the request. A DCC payment consists of two parts:
1. A CURRENCYRATE Request Requests an up-to-date conversion rate from a DCC
provider.
2. An AUTH Request Requests the acquiring bank to authorise the payment in the
customer’s preferred currency.
Please note that in certain configurations, these additional fields are not required.
Please see section 7.5.4, for more information.
The customer is initially shown a choice page, where they can select the payment type that they
wish to use. This is the same as the normal payment type choice page, except the amount is
initially hidden (Figure 15). This is because the currencies and respective amounts to be
offered to the customer have yet to be established.
Figure 15 - DCC Payment Pages: Payment type choice page
Payment Pages Setup Guide
© Secure Trading Limited 2015
31 December 2015
Page 42 / 77
If the customer chooses a payment type that supports DCC, they are informed that they are
able to pay in an alternative currency to the merchant currency submitted, as shown in Figure
16. Here they will be able to see the amount in the merchant currency.
Secure Trading’s implementation of DCC is currently only supported by
MasterCard and Visa branded cards.
Figure 16 - DCC Payment Pages: DCC first page
Secure Trading will use the card number (PAN) entered by the customer to establish their local
currency, by submitting the information in a CURRENCYRATE Request. The conversion rate
partner will supply a conversion rate that is used to convert the amount in the merchant
currency to an amount in the customer’s local currency.
Please note that if the cardholder’s local currency is the same as the currency
you submitted, the customer will not be shown a conversion rate and instead will
make the payment in your account’s currency.
Please note that amounts paid in the customer’s currency have a small fee
added to them to cover the cost of the conversion by the third-party conversion
rate provider. This fee is determined by calculating a percentage of the amount in
the customer’s currency and adding this to the total amount. For more
information, please contact your conversion rate provider.

9.6 Response Site Security
This section is only relevant to merchants that have implemented site
security on their Payment Pages solution. For more information on configuring
site security for the first time, please see section 6.
If site security has been enabled on your Payment Pages solution, you will also receive a
hashed responsesitesecurity value in any redirects and URL notifications sent to your
system, following transactions processed using Payment Pages.
Secure Trading strongly recommends that you recalculate the responsesitesecurity hash
returned, to ensure it has not been modified by a customer or third party and that the fields were
sent by Secure Trading. This is generated using a similar method for the request site security,
as previously described section 6. Please read on for further information.
If you are using custom (“UDR”) rules for URL notifications, you will need to opt-in
to response site security when creating the action, but the method used to
generate the hash remains the same.
Payment Pages Setup Guide
© Secure Trading Limited 2015
31 December 2015
Page 58 / 77
9.6.1 Hash generation
The hash is generated in the same way as when including site security in your HTTPS POST,
except the order the fields are appended before they are hashed is different (as described in
step 1 below).
Step 1
Append all values of the fields included in the redirect or URL notification in ASCII alphabetical
order, with the password placed at the end (ignoring the responsesitesecurity field itself).
For information on ASCII alphabetical order, please refer to this Wikipedia page:
http://en.wikipedia.org/wiki/ASCII
Please note that the password used when generating the hash is the same
password previously agreed with Secure Trading Support when configuring site
security for the HTTPS POST.
If you are using custom (“UDR”) rules for URL notifications, you can specify a
different password when creating the action, if needed.
For example, consider a redirect or URL notification with the following fields:
Field Name
Field Value
Position
errorcode
0
1st
orderreference
Order
2nd
paymenttypedescription
VISA
3rd
requestreference
RR555
4th
settlestatus
0
5th
sitereference
test_site12345
6th
transactionreference
2-44-66
7th
password
PASSWORD
8th
Using the example above, we would have the following string generated:
0OrderVISARR5550test_site123452-44-66PASSWORD
(Any blank fields are omitted from the hash)
If the fields are not in ASCII alphabetical order, the hash you generate will
be incorrect. The password must always be at the end of the string.
Payment Pages Setup Guide
© Secure Trading Limited 2015
31 December 2015
Page 59 / 77
Step 2
Hash the fields using the same algorithm used in the HTTPS POST (by default this is sha256).
This generates the value that should be returned in redirects and URL notifications with the field
values specified in step 1:
e3b0c44298fc1c149afbf4c8996fb92427ae41e4649b934ca495991b7852b855
Note: The response site security isn’t prefixed with a “g” as in the request site security.

10.2.3 Request Sequence
If multiple request types are sent in a single Enhanced Post request, they are always processed
in a specific order defined by Secure Trading; regardless of the order the request types are
submitted. This order is as follows:
Order (starting from 1)
Request Type
1
CURRENCYRATE
2
RISKDEC
3
ACCOUNTCHECK
4
ORDER
5
THREEDQUERY
6
ORDERDETAILS
7
AUTH
8
SUBSCRIPTION
Payment Pages Setup Guide
© Secure Trading Limited 2015
31 December 2015
Page 66 / 77
10.2.4 Request Priority
With the enhanced POST feature, there are priorities that are assigned to certain request types.
Request types are classed as High-Priority if they are required in order to transfer funds and
Low-Priority if they are NOT able to directly transfer funds, as shown in the table, below:
Request Type(s)
Priority
AUTH
SUBSCRIPTIONS
HIGH
ACCOUNTCHECK
CURRENCYRATE
ORDER
ORDERDETAILS
RISKDEC
THREEDQUERY
LOW
If a SINGLE (e.g. AUTH) High-Priority request type is sent, then the payment methods shown
are ones that are able to process the high priority request.
If MULTIPLE (e.g. AUTH and SUBSCRIPTION) High-Priority request types are sent in a single
request, then the payment methods shown will be those that can perform both request types
(e.g. Maestro which cannot perform SUBSCRIPTIONS will not be shown)
If a High-Priority (e.g. AUTH) request type is sent along with a Low-Priority (e.g.
ACCOUNTCHECK) request type in a single request, then the High-Priority request takes
precedence over the Low-Priority. Only the payment types that are able to process the High-
Priority request will be shown to the customer(s) (even though they may not be able to process
the Low-Priority request).
If a SINGLE Low-Priority (e.g. ACCOUNTCHECK) request type is sent on its own, this behaves
the same as a High-Priority request, and displays all payment types that are able to process
that request type.
If MULTIPLE Low-Priority (e.g. ACCOUNTCHECK and RISKDEC) request types are sent in a
single request, then the payment methods shown will be those that can perform both request
types.

10.4.1 Relationship between subscriptions and account checks
When specifying ACCOUNTCHECK and SUBSCRIPTION request types in an enhanced post,
Secure Trading will perform checks on the customer’s details before scheduling a subscription.
You will need to contact Support to set up rules to automatically suspend transactions where
the results of the ACCOUNTCHECK indicate details entered by the customer do not match
those held on their bank’s records. If the ACCOUNTCHECK is successful, subsequent
payments will be automatically processed at regular intervals by the subscription engine. As
ACCOUNTCHECKs do not reserve funds on the customer’s account, no payment is processed
for the first interval (e.g. for a monthly subscription, the first payment is only processed after the
first month).
When specifying AUTH and SUBSCRIPTION request types in an enhanced post, Secure
Trading will process the first payment immediately and schedule further payments in the
subscription engine if the funds were settled successfully.
When specifying ACCOUNTCHECK, AUTH and SUBSCRIPTION request types in an
enhanced post, Secure Trading will perform checks on the customer’s details before processing
the first payment. Please contact Support to configure rules to suspend transactions where the
results of the ACCOUNTCHECK indicate details entered by the customer do not match those
held on their bank’s records. If the ACCOUNTCHECK is successful, the first payment will be
processed immediately. Secure Trading will schedule further payments in the subscription
engine if funds from the first transaction were settled successfully.

17 Appendix
17.1 Settle status
Settle
status
Caption
Description
0
Pending
settlement
Transaction that has been authorised by card issuer for payment.
Settles automatically.
Can be updated or cancelled.
Does not currently require action from the merchant.
May be suspended by future fraud and duplicate checks,
if enabled (see Fraud checks document).
1
Manual
settlement
Transaction that has been authorised by card issuer for payment.
Settles automatically.
Can be updated or cancelled.
Does not require further action from merchant.
Bypasses fraud and duplicate checks, if enabled (see
Fraud checks document).
10
Settling
The transaction is in the process of being settled.
Settles automatically.
Does not require further action from merchant.
Cannot be updated or cancelled.
100
Settled
Transaction has been settled into the merchant’s account.
Does not require further action from merchant.
Cannot be updated or cancelled.
Can be refunded (unless all funds have already been
refunded).
2
Suspended
Transaction is in a suspended state, awaiting further action from
the merchant.
Will not be settled unless updated by the merchant to
settle status ‘0’ or ‘1’.
Alternatively, merchants can cancel this transaction by
updating the settle status to ‘3’.
Transactions can be suspended by merchants to prevent
settlement, allowing for manual investigation.
Transactions can be suspended by Secure Trading if
fraud or duplicate checks (if enabled) raise an issue (see
Fraud checks document).
If left in a suspended state, Secure Trading will
automatically cancel the transaction 7 days after the
authorisation date.
3
Cancelled
Transaction has been cancelled and will not settle.
This can be due to an error or due to the transaction
being declined.
Merchants can also update the settle status to '3' to
manually cancel transactions.
Cancelled transactions cannot be updated.
